Аноньчик, хочу начать программировать чисто для себя. На гения не претендую. Не чтоб зарабатывать, а хочу освоить что-то новое. Ворваться в какую-то тему и пыхтеть над ней часами, вникать там, бомбить с ебучих неудач, радоваться что что-то получается. Что посоветуешь, анон? С чего начать? Может литература какая, аль ще чего? Не могу структурировать поток каких-то конченных советов для нуфагов в этой теме.
>>240493836 Я вообще, блять, просто сел и решил начать. Я даже не знаю с чего стоит начать изучение, я ж поэтому и пишу, мол, дай совет, простой Иван город Тверь. Что подойдет для изучения нуфагу. Начну, а потом возможно буду вникать на чем заострять внимание
>>240493707 (OP) Герберт Шилдт, Блинов, Романчик - у них хорошие книги по Java. Флёнов и его "Программирование на С глазами хакера" тоже весьма занятная вещь
>>240494043 Пока отлично, все доходчиво, с ходу начинаешь первые маленькие программки писать А вообще зайди в /pr, там в треде любого языка список литературы для ньюфагов есть
>>240493707 (OP) >Ворваться в какую-то тему и пыхтеть над ней часами, вникать там, бомбить с ебучих неудач, радоваться что что-то получается. Ты уже обосрался. Нахуй что-то дальше делать. Вместо того чтоб псидеть попыхтеть, загуглить какие языки есть\что на них пишут\какие есть направления в кодинге\что и где учить, ты высрал свое говно на двач. Наверни лучше смешнявок в засмеялся-обосрался , подрочи в фап и иди спать
>>240494180 Блять, да я нефритовый стержень знает. Статей изучено овердохуя. Кто-то советует начать с питона, кто-то пишет, мол, "врывайся сразу в яву". Литературу каждый ебучий писатель рекомендует свою, она у каждого различна, ее овердохуя. Поэтому я пишу на двач, где простой Иван город Тверь скажет свой опыт и посоветует. А не начнет толкать коммерческую статейку от ИТ БОГА
>>240494353 Открою тебе страшную тайну. Язык не имеет значения. Это инструмент. Нет смысла выбирать 3 часа себе молоток, если ты гвозди не умеешь забивать. Бери любой и учись.
>>240493707 (OP) >Аноньчик, хочу начатьпрограммировать чисто для себя. >Что посоветуешь, анон? Советую начать программировать > С чего начать? С hello, world! >Может литература какая, аль ще чего? Да, литература есть разная
>>240494353 Да какая нахуй разница? Питон, ява, си, блядь. Берешь любой язык и пишешь код, не нравится - берешь другой. > Статей изучено овердохуя. Ну красавец, чо, ты отлично продвинулся в чтении статей. Твоя цель ведь в этом была?
>>240494353 >Поэтому я пишу на двач, где простой Иван город Тверь скажет свой опыт и посоветует Щас тебе каждый ебучий простой Иван город Тверь будет рекомендовать своё исходя из своего опыта. Это тебе сильно поможет? Пора уже принимать решения самостоятельно и получать собственный опыт
>>240493707 (OP) Во-первых, не слушай java-петухов. Во-вторых, никогда не слушай java-петухов. В-третьих, учи языки из энтерпрайз сферы: Си, Си-шарп(Net.core) ИЛИ альтернативно - питон, он чисто для бизнес-АНАЛитики подойдет, без лишнего дрочева.
>>240493707 (OP) Советую гейдев. Посмотри вводное видео по phaser 3, потом шестичасовой курс базы яваскрипта, потом любой туториал по фейзеру.. И начинай писать свои игры, подтягивая знания по всем направлениям. Сокеты, рендеринг, пиксельарт, там дохуя интересного и как хобби идеально подходит.
>>240493707 (OP) Вообще я бы советовал не дрочить какой-то конкретный язык, а для начала хотя бы базовые алгоритмы изучить без привязки к языкам. Потому что после изучения синтаксиса и понимания принципов того же ООП, дальше у тебя всё будет упираться в дрочево разных алгоритмов, а это пиздец какая скучная и не всегда простая тема.
Я тоже для себя немного кодинг копаю, просто чтобы с этим 3д-моушеном и моделингом-пердолингом с ума не сойти, так вот часто бывает, что упрусь в решение какой-то задачи и не понимаю, как именно она решена много смех. Читаю комменты на форумах, разборы смотрю, а всё равно нихуя не понимаю. Чувствую себя тупым. Но где-то через неделю до меня доходит таки. Или бывает такое, что как работает - понимаю, но не понимаю зачем.
Короче, если ты сам по себе не дохуя айтишник-технарь-математик, то я бы посоветовал лучше просто какую-нибудь математику позадрачивать, просто мозг потренировать, без привязки к программированию.
В свое время начинал с книжки про программирование игр, позволила не потеряв интереса разобраться с основами - переменными, циклами, типами. Потом фактически за вечер познакомился с питоном, читал доку по его стандартной библиотеке, и тут же проверял как там что работает.
Что посоветовать тебе - хз ))). Если тебе и в правду для себя - начни с чего-то с коротким циклом обратной связи - питон, руби или го. Потом как втянешься - сам разберёшься, куда тебе копать интереснее будет.
Советовали сикп, но я его не читал - прокомментировать не могу, но тоже можешь попробовать.
Чё ещё... Мне помогли книги "Язык программирования C# и платформа .Net", хотя шарп я и так знал заполнил пробелы в знаниях, "SQL и реляционная теория". Собственно, работаю с postgres и шарпом
>>240493707 (OP) Да еще, если плохо осваиваешь языки (не программирования) тоже вряд ли что получится. По сути это очень похожие навыки, и помогающие потом переходить на другие языки, расширять возможности.
Везет, я пытался вкатиться в с++ в универе, в питон-жаву на мотивационном подъеме. Все дропнул после массивов, когда надо было по-настоящему начать программировать. Вообще не могу в алгоритмы. Мне так жаль, что я тупой
>>240495454 Это реальная проблемя на самом деле, даже на физ уровне. - программист должен уметь печатать вслепую - программист должен осознавать когда отдохнуть его пальцам, а то пизда, это не кулаками махать, износ суставов серьезная проблема современности - зрение опять таки - геморрой
>>240495589 Для освоения массивов нужно хорошо их представить, 2д массивы еще норм, а 3д уже пиздец, еще многопоточность ебать, которая очень связана с программированием самообучаемой нейросетки, смотрел видос где чел вроде бы разжевывает это все по пальцам и с результатом, но этих палцев и условностей все больше и больше, мозг не выдерживает, информация всё идёт и идет, возможно он тоже этому всему не сразу научился, и поэтому так сложно.
>>240493707 (OP) Учи шарп, самый нормальный язык правда я другого не знаю. Можно и игры писать, и для мобилок и сайты правда ява-скрипт и хтмл придётся ещё подучить и с бд работать. Любой самоучитель по шарпу бери, разберёшься.
>>240495634 Да я ни туда, ни туда. Надо было на геолога идти, на камешки бы смотрел >>240495655 Массивы понимаю. После массивов в универе шли ООП и просто решение всяких задач. На задачах жопу рвало, потому что они и математически сложные (и даже хз что они решают и куда их вставить), а уж в программировании вообще. Я просто быстро теряю интерес (потому что тупой, не получается) и не могу нормально учить Спасибо, простой Иван город Тверь, ты добр! Наверное, максимум, что я смогу когда-либо выучить - тестирование. работаю в инет-магазинах
>>240495604 > Должен Не умею печатать в слепую. Отдых суставам, много смех. Я набором текста занимаюсь где-то 1-2% от всего времени разработки. Ты там вообще не думаешь что писать?
У меня знакомый в 26 лет решил с инженегра в погроммиста перепрофилироваться, четыре года самообучался в качестве хобби, потом устроился в конторку, там уже пятый год пошел как работает, зряплата в котосибирске у него 180-200к. Для наших пердей это царский заработок для наемного работника.
>>240496125 Программист. Вопрос к тому, что у тебя, вероятно, набор текста занимает слишком большую долю времени для такого незначительного занятия, что суставы устают.
>>240496235 Трафиком в основном. Собираю данные, укладываю в БД, дашборды рисую, анализирую, думаю, как бы эффективнее рекламный бюджет реализовывать и как бы удобнее сайт и приложение сделать. Python, SQL, Power BI. Раньше ещё на R ебашил, но забросил его
>>240496267 >Вопрос к тому, что у тебя Причем тут я, это общая проблема программистов и тех кто много печатает. Статья на хабре была про программиста, который уже не мог печатать и программировал игру уже голосовыми командами, придумал какую-то быструю систему команд, которая стала популярной среди таких же программистов. >Программирую на всех языках. Жир потёк.
>>240495931 Я был таким же на первом курсе универа, нормально писать начал ближе к диплому. Глянь на metanit, там всё подробно расписано. Я вкатился в мобильную разработку (просто ради интереса) по гайдам оттуда. Хотя, правда, ещё до этого знал язык
>>240496552 > >JS > дурачок. Самый горячий рынок во всем АйТи с самыми высокими зарплатами в паблике, где предлагают 250к челику, который отличит реакт от вуе и ангкляр от ангуляржс. Надо подумать, кто из нас дурачок.
>>240496223 не вкатываться в qa. хотя, кому как. на мой взгляд - скучнейшая ебанина и у каждой компании разное понимание того, что должен делать qa 1) где-то тебе нужно будет творчески ломать приложуху и искать варианты сделать лучше 2) а где-то ты просто будешь сидеть как в отделе ОТК и тебя буду штрафовать и наказывать за пропущенные баги. ТЫ ЖЕ ТЕСТИРОВЩИК. короч, хз. мне лично программирование ближе
>>240497467 Ты сам признался, няша. Не стесняйся, я тебя даже таким люблю. >>240497481 >спорить с долбоёбами С тобой никто и не спорил, дурашка. >>240497518 >≠ Ох уж эти омежные программистишки.
>>240493707 (OP) Анончик хочу стать грузчиком чисто для себя. На гения не претендую. Не чтоб зарабатывать, а хочу освоить чтото новое. Таскать ящики пыхтеть над ними часами, вникать там, бомбить с ебучих неудач радоваться что что-то получается. Что посоветуешь, анон? С чего начать? Может литература какая, аль ще чего? Не могу структурировать поток каких-то конченных советов для нуфагов в этой теме.
>>240493707 (OP) ты долбаеб? для себя лучше спортом займись, научись играть на музыкальном инструмента, а изучать прогерство надо только если в безвыходной ситуации. По факту прогерство это говно